I might have found a solution to the problem. Open the powerline software, click (or was ir right click?) on the icon for the powerplugs in the upper left corner. Choose Quality of Service (QoS) uncheck "VLAN tags" apply changes.
This seems to have worked for me but still to early to say anything conclusive. I'll post back in a week or earlier if any problems occur.
